Transaction 75433c3baccb0d28ebb923bab584de5669e650d8084e96472f5351ad66451ba3
1 Input
1 Output
-
75433c3baccb0d28ebb923bab584de5669e650d8084e96472f5351ad66451ba3:0
- value
- 49982932
- script pubkey
- OP_0 OP_PUSHBYTES_20 d851f4dc631cedb5cb426a1d9d3828a8a6450006
- address
- bc1qmpglfhrrrnkmtj6zdgwe6wpg4zny2qqxqj7hvc